neu-rah commented 4 years ago

had similar issue in two cases:

1) with arduino framework because the softdevice file was missing, upload only shows a warning about not finding the file (in verbose mode) and terminates without error (firmware.hex contains only user version and is quite small)

2) with mbed OS 5, compile upload ok but nothing happens... by turning on Serial printing I was then able to see the error on terminal (serial monitor)
